job 31:23 For destruction from God was a terror to me, and by reason of his highness I could not endure. - Free Bible Online

job 31:23 "For calamity from God is a terror to me, And because of His majesty I can do nothing.


      23. For--that is, the reason why Job guarded against such sins. Fear of God, though he could escape man's judgment (Ge 39:9). UMBREIT more spiritedly translates, Yea, destruction and terror from God might have befallen me (had I done so): mere fear not being the motive.
      highness--majestic might.
      endure--I could have availed nothing against it.

JFB.
